    ## What is Safety Stock Management?
    
    ### Definition
    Safety Stock Management refers to the practice of maintaining extra inventory beyond what is immediately required to fulfill current demand. This buffer stock acts as an insurance policy against uncertainties such as supply chain disruptions, unexpected demand spikes, or delays in production and distribution.
    
    ### Key Characteristics
    1. **Buffer Inventory**: Safety stock serves as a safeguard to prevent stockouts and ensure continuous product availability.
    2. **Demand Forecasting**: Accurate forecasting is critical to determine the optimal level of safety stock.
    3. **Risk Management**: It mitigates risks associated with variability in supply, demand, and lead times.
    4. **Cost-Benefit Analysis**: Balancing the cost of holding extra inventory against the potential losses from stockouts.
    
    ### History
    The concept of maintaining safety stock dates back to early manufacturing practices where businesses kept excess materials to avoid production halts. However, it gained prominence with the advent of the Just-in-Time (JIT) methodology in the 1970s, which emphasized lean operations but also highlighted the need for buffers to maintain flexibility.
    
    ### Importance
    Safety Stock Management is essential because:
    - **Prevents Stockouts**: Ensures products are available when customers demand them.
    - **Reduces Production Delays**: Mitigates risks of supply chain disruptions affecting manufacturing schedules.
    - **Improves Customer Satisfaction**: Consistent product availability enhances customer loyalty and trust.

    ## What is Logistics Strategy?
    
    ### Definition
    A Logistics Strategy is a comprehensive plan that outlines how an organization will manage the movement, storage, and distribution of goods and services. It focuses on optimizing efficiency, reducing costs, and improving service levels while aligning with broader business objectives.
    
    ### Key Characteristics
    1. **Integrated Approach**: Combines various functions such as transportation, warehousing, inventory management, and order fulfillment.
    2. **Customer-Centricity**: Prioritizes meeting customer expectations for delivery times, product condition, and cost-effectiveness.
    3. **Technology-Driven**: Leverages tools like ERP systems, route optimization software, and IoT devices to enhance operations.
    4. **Scalability**: Adaptable to changing market conditions and business growth.
    
    ### History
    Logistics Strategy as a formal concept emerged in the mid-20th century with the development of transportation networks and supply chain theories. Over time, advancements in technology and globalization have expanded its scope, making it a critical component of modern supply chain management.
    
    ### Importance
    A well-defined Logistics Strategy is vital because:
    - **Enhances Efficiency**: Streamlines operations to reduce lead times and minimize waste.
    - **Reduces Costs**: Optimizes resource utilization and lowers transportation and storage expenses.
    - **Improves Competitiveness**: Enables faster delivery, better service levels, and a competitive edge in the market.

    ## Key Differences
    
    1. **Scope**:
       - **Safety Stock Management**: Focuses on inventory management at specific points in the supply chain (e.g., warehouses or retail stores).
       - **Logistics Strategy**: Encompasses the entire supply chain, including transportation, warehousing, and distribution.
    
    2. **Focus Area**:
       - **Safety Stock Management**: Primarily concerned with maintaining adequate inventory levels to prevent stockouts.
       - **Logistics Strategy**: Aims to optimize the flow of goods from suppliers to end customers while minimizing costs and enhancing service quality.
    
    3. **Objective**:
       - **Safety Stock Management**: Minimize the risk of stockouts by maintaining a buffer inventory.
       - **Logistics Strategy**: Maximize efficiency, reduce operational costs, and improve customer satisfaction through strategic planning.
    
    4. **Implementation**:
       - **Safety Stock Management**: Relies on demand forecasting models and statistical analysis to determine optimal safety stock levels.
       - **Logistics Strategy**: Involves collaboration across departments, leveraging technology, and aligning with broader business goals.
    
    5. **Impact**:
       - **Safety Stock Management**: Directly impacts inventory carrying costs and order fulfillment rates.
       - **Logistics Strategy**: Influences overall supply chain performance, including delivery times, cost efficiency, and customer satisfaction.

    ## Use Cases
    
    ### When to Use Safety Stock Management
    - **Seasonal Products**: For items with fluctuating demand (e.g., holiday decorations), maintaining safety stock ensures availability during peak periods.
    - **Uncertain Demand**: Industries like healthcare or electronics, where demand can be unpredictable, benefit from buffer inventory.
    - **Long Lead Times**: Products with extended production cycles require higher safety stock levels to avoid delays.
    
    ### When to Use Logistics Strategy
    - **E-commerce Fulfillment**: Companies like Amazon rely on a robust logistics strategy to ensure fast and reliable delivery of products worldwide.
    - **Global Supply Chains**: Multinational corporations use logistics strategies to manage cross-border shipments efficiently.
    - **Just-in-Time (JIT) Manufacturing**: Industries adopting JIT practices need a well-coordinated logistics strategy to maintain smooth operations.

    ## Real-World Examples
    
    ### Safety Stock Management
    - **Retail Industry**: Supermarkets maintain safety stock of perishable goods to ensure continuous availability despite fluctuating demand or supply chain delays.
    
    ### Logistics Strategy
    - **E-commerce Giants**: Amazon’s logistics strategy includes a network of fulfillment centers and advanced routing algorithms to deliver products quickly and efficiently.
    - **Automotive Sector**: Companies like Toyota use a logistics strategy that integrates JIT principles with global supplier networks to maintain lean operations.
